Why does your pet need routine grooming?

Routine grooming of your pet doesn’t just keeps your pet’s fur looking awesome, but it also helps preserve your dog’s fur and physical health and wellbeing. When your pet gets grooming, it prevents painful tangling and knots in their coat, eliminates the development of bacteria and hot-spots (dermatitis), and keeps thedog free from pests like bugs. During your dog’s grooming session, your Seward dog groomer will keep an eye out for lumps and injuries that could progress into a health issue.


How often should my dog be groomed?

Grooming needs for your dog will differ depending on the breed, hair and your dog’s habits. Some dogs only require sporadic bath, brush and nail trim whereas other dog breeds may need more regular brushing or even focused brushing in their season change of coat.. Normally, most pet parents book frequent grooming on a monthly basis. For pups and dogs who have not been groomed yet, more consistent burshing at home should be done to get the pet used to being handled and to avoid grooming problems into adulthood. What’s the difference between a dog bathing and grooming service?

Dog bathing services incorporate: 1-3 rounds of shampoo, 1 round of conditioner, hand-dry as allowed by pet, brush and/or comb out.

Dog grooming consist of: Everything included above in bathing as well as a full cut/style based on breed standards and/or your specific needs, nails trimmed, and ears cleaned.

Do Seward groomers offer pet dogs sedatives?

Pet groomers in Seward Alaska can’t legally sedate a pet dog. If the groomer operates in a veterinary medical facility the veterinarian can authorize sedation however it is given by a technician. In the case of oral medications that a vet has recommended, an owner can give it to the pet prior to a grooming visit, as it takes about an hour to be efficient.

How do you groom a dog with scissors?

Starting at the top of your pet’s head, comb any fur forward and up out of your pet dog’s eyes. Cut with scissors to any length you ‘d like. Use short blade scissors to cut around your pet’s eyes and for his beard. Place your fingers at the tip of your dog’s ear to avoid cutting the skin.

Can you cut a double coated canine?

You can still cut a lot of the coat off but not shave so close as to shave undercoat. Remove as much of the undercoat as possible prior to trimming the outer coat. This may permit you to select a bit much shorter guard comb alternative. Do not just rake the jacket or back of the pet.
